网络工程师工具:python批量生成配置

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了网络工程师工具:python批量生成配置相关的知识,希望对你有一定的参考价值。

诉求:网络工程实施过程中,配置量巨大,人工输出耗时长,配置错误率高;因此通过脚本来实现配置快速输出,提高配置输出的可靠性和以及效率

 

前提:安装好python3.0+,并通过pip 安装xlrd(cmd下执行pip install xlrd

执行不了的话,要在pip的绝对路径下。

1、     填写”信息库”

 

 技术分享

技术分享

 

2、填写压缩文件或txt需要生成的配置

 技术分享

 

3、执行脚本

 技术分享

 

不行的话,可以按照以下方式执行,打开IDLE

 技术分享

 

4、查看执行结果

 技术分享

 

文件名::test+时间

 技术分享

技术分享

 

 技术分享

代码下载链接:https://github.com/keyongzeng/produceConfigurationv1

以上是关于网络工程师工具:python批量生成配置的主要内容,如果未能解决你的问题,请参考以下文章

网络设备-批量自动配置备份软件Kiwi cattools使用介绍

脚本Windows批量验证TCP端口连通性

这21个网络工程师必备工具,都是老杨的私人珍藏。

网络工程师的Pyhont实战

2019-05-30 Python+Jinja2+yaml 批量生成配置

网络安全工程师分享的6大渗透测试必备工具